Abstract
Background Published data on influenza in severe acute respiratory infection ( SARI) patients are limited. We conducted SARI surveillance in central China and estimated hospitalization rates of SARI attributable to influenza by viral type/subtype. Methods Surveillance was conducted at four hospitals in Jingzhou, China from 2010 to 2012. We enrolled hospitalized patients who had temperature ≥37·3°C and at least one of: cough, sore throat, tachypnea, difficulty breathing, abnormal breath sounds on auscultation, sputum production, hemoptysis, chest pain, or chest radiograph consistent with pneumonia. A nasopharyngeal swab was collected from each case-patient within 24 hours of admission for influenza testing by real-time reverse transcription PCR. Results Of 17 172 SARI patients enrolled, 90% were aged <15 years. The median duration of hospitalization was 5 days. Of 16 208 (94%) SARI cases tested, 2057 (13%) had confirmed influenza, including 1427 (69%) aged <5 years. Multiple peaks of influenza occurred during summer, winter, and spring months. Influenza was associated with an estimated 115 and 142 SARI hospitalizations per 100 000 during 2010-2011 and 2011-2012 [including A(H3N2): 55 and 44 SARI hospitalizations per 100 000; pandemic A(H1N1): 33 SARI hospitalizations per 100 000 during 2010-2011; influenza B: 26 and 98 hospitalizations per 100 000], with the highest rate among children aged 6-11 months (3603 and 3805 hospitalizations per 100 000 during 2010-2011 and 2011-2012, respectively). Conclusions In central China, influenza A and B caused a substantial number of hospitalizations during multiple periods each year. Our findings strongly suggest that young children should be the highest priority group for annual influenza vaccination in China. [ABSTRACT FROM AUTHOR]
